Start your training journey on the right paw with these helpful pointers. First and foremost, ensure that your doggo is familiar with new people and places. A well-socialized dog has a higher chance of succeeding in training.

Next, establish clear boundaries. Consistency is essential. Dogs thrive on routine and knowing what is expected of them. Use rewards-based methods to motivate good behavior.

Finally, be patient and dedicated. Training takes time and dedication. Don't get discouraged if your dog doesn't pick things up right away.

Understanding Your Dog's Tail Wags

A dog's tail is more than just a cute appendage; it's a complex communication tool that can reveal tons of information about how your furry friend is feeling. While a wagging tail often signifies happiness, the rhythm of the wag and its position can offer deeper insights into your dog's state of mind. A slow, gentle wag may indicate relaxation, while a fast, vigorous wag could show eagerness. Pay attention to the whole situation – your dog's body language, facial expressions, and vocalizations – for a more accurate interpretation of their tail wags.

  • Think about, a wagging tail held high might suggest confidence, while a low, tucked tail could show anxiety.

By learning to interpret your dog's tail wags, you can build your bond and develop a deeper understanding of their needs and emotions.
